A Plea for Divine Renewal: The Heartfelt Cry in 'Dios Manda Lluvia'

Alex Campos' song 'Dios Manda Lluvia' is a poignant and heartfelt plea for spiritual renewal and divine intervention. The lyrics are a direct appeal to God, asking for rain as a metaphor for the outpouring of the Holy Spirit. This rain symbolizes healing, restoration, and transformation, which are central themes in the song. The repetition of the phrase 'Dios manda lluvia' (God, send rain) emphasizes the urgency and deep longing for divine presence and action in the singer's life.

The song's imagery of rain and dew is rich with biblical connotations. Rain is often used in the Bible to signify God's blessing and favor, as well as a means of cleansing and renewal. By asking for rain, the singer is not just seeking physical rain but a spiritual downpour that will heal wounds, restore brokenness, and bring about a profound change. The mention of 'rocío de tu amor' (dew of your love) further underscores the gentle yet powerful nature of God's love and its ability to refresh and rejuvenate the soul.

Alex Campos, known for his contemporary Christian music, often incorporates themes of faith, hope, and redemption in his work. 'Dios Manda Lluvia' is no exception, as it reflects a deep personal and communal desire for God's intervention in times of need. The song's simple yet powerful lyrics resonate with many who seek comfort and strength from a higher power. It serves as a reminder of the transformative power of faith and the importance of seeking divine help in our lives.
